# TICKET-4821: Signature check failing on heuristic plugin

Plugins for the Routabel driver-assignment heuristic are rejected at load time with `SIG_MISMATCH`. Cause: the verifier was rotated last Tuesday, but the plugin docs still reference the retired key. Action for plugin authors: re-sign your bundle and resubmit through the Cartwheel portal. Old signatures will stop validating entirely at end of month. Sign against the current key, shown here:

rollout seal: bky9_aBG1gvAyU

This PR adds bounded retries to the Ledgerfall export worker. Previously a single transient failure dropped the whole batch; now we retry with exponential backoff and jitter, and dead-letter after the cap. All values live in one place so future tuning is a one-line change. The current retry parameters are defined here.

tuning table, faduf-baduf:
PRIORITIES = {
    "ulavan": 191,
    "silys": 750,
    "goriel": 238,
    "kelmir": 66,
    "wendor": 432,
}

LEADERSHIP REVIEW — Marliden Retail Pilot

Sales leads: the six-store pilot with Marliden Goods launched on schedule in the Veldane region. Shelf integration of the Quanta rack system is complete. Early sell-through exceeds forecast by 12%. Marliden's buyer, Tomas Reski, has requested expansion terms ahead of the review window. Hold all external commitments until leadership signs off. Next steps are outlined below.

internal memo for yahag-hahig: Belwynix Group plans to lower the Silir list price by 62 percent in May.

Internal Memo — Board Distribution

Quick update on the second-source hunt for the Vantor 9 sensor module. As you know, we're over-reliant on Kestrel Fabrication, and their lead times keep drifting. We've shortlisted two alternatives: Braddon Micro and a newer shop called Oleander Works. Samples from both are in qualification now; early yields look promising. We expect a recommendation before the next board session. The confidential supplier terms and risk assessment follow below.

board note of kageg-bahof: The renewal with Holwynax Holdings closes at $2 million a year, 5 percent below the last contract. Project Ulaath slips by two quarters because of the supplier delay.